Another group of former IDPs receives keys to homes in Khojavand's Girmizi Bazar UPDATED / PHOTO

17 December 2025 18:00

Another group of internally displaced persons arriving in the settlement of Girmizi Bazar in the Khojavand district received the keys to their new homes.

ANAMA officials provided the newcomers with detailed information on the risks of mines and unexploded ordnance, Caliber.Az reports per local media.

They were advised to stay away from unfamiliar objects and report any suspicious items to the relevant authorities.

The key handover ceremony was attended by representatives from the Special Presidential Office for the Aghdam, Fuzuli, and Khojavand districts, the State Committee for Refugees and Internally Displaced Persons, and other officials. Families warmly received the keys and settled into their homes.

It should be noted that at this stage, 18 families — a total of 90 people — have been relocated to the village of Girmizi Bazar. They had previously been temporarily settled in various locations.

Families arriving in Khojavand, Aghdam, and Lachin have officially received the keys to their new homes.

On December 17, a new group of displaced people arrived in the Girmizi Bazar settlement of the Khojavand district, Caliber.Az reports per local media.

Keys to apartments were handed over to 18 families, totalling 90 people, resettled in Girmizi Bazar.

Additionally, keys to apartments were handed over to 16 families, comprising 45 people, who were sent to the village of Khydyrly in the Aghdam district.

Moreover, the next group of displaced people reached the settlement of Hadrut in Khojavand, consisting of 6 families, totalling 26 people.

The ceremony in the Aghdam, Fuzuli, and Khojavand districts was attended by representatives of the Presidential Special Envoy of the Republic of Azerbaijan and the State Committee for Refugees and Internally Displaced Persons.

On the same day, another group of displaced people arrived in Lachin city, where keys to apartments were handed over to 17 families, comprising 69 people.

Representatives of the Presidential Special Envoy for the Lachin district and the State Committee for Refugees and Internally Displaced Persons attended the key handover ceremony.

Another group of former internally displaced persons has departed for the city of Lachin, the settlements of Hadrut and Girmizi Bazar in the Khojavand district, and the village of Khydyrly in the Aghdam district.

At this stage, 17 families (69 people) are returning to Lachin, six families (26 people) to Hadrut, 18 families (91 people) to Girmizi Bazar, and 16 families (45 people) to Khydyrly, Caliber.Az reports per local media.

The families had previously been temporarily housed in dormitories, sanatoriums, children’s camps, unfinished buildings, and administrative facilities.

Following the victory of the Azerbaijani Army in the Patriotic War under the leadership of President and Supreme Commander-in-Chief Ilham Aliyev, former internally displaced persons have been given the opportunity to return to their homeland voluntarily, safely, and with dignity after 30 years.
